
Modifying a car to sound like a Lamborghini involves enhancing its exhaust system to mimic the distinctive, aggressive roar of a high-performance Italian supercar. This can be achieved through several methods, such as installing aftermarket exhaust systems designed to replicate the Lamborghini sound, adding resonators or muffler deletes, or using electronic sound simulators that amplify and alter the engine noise. While these modifications can dramatically transform the auditory experience, it’s essential to ensure compliance with local noise regulations and consider the impact on the vehicle’s performance and longevity. Achieving an authentic Lamborghini sound requires careful selection of components and professional installation to balance aesthetics, legality, and functionality.

Exhaust System Upgrades: Modify mufflers, pipes, and tips for deeper, louder sound resembling Lamborghini's signature exhaust note
The Lamborghini's exhaust note is a symphony of power, a deep, throaty roar that announces its presence long before it comes into view. To replicate this iconic sound, one must delve into the heart of the exhaust system, where mufflers, pipes, and tips play a crucial role in shaping the auditory experience. Upgrading these components can transform a mundane car's exhaust note into a Lamborghini-esque crescendo, but it requires careful consideration and precision.
Analyzing the Components: A Lamborghini's exhaust system is designed to minimize backpressure while maximizing sound resonance. The muffler, often a high-flow or straight-through design, allows exhaust gases to exit with minimal restriction, contributing to the deep, aggressive tone. Pipes, typically wider in diameter, reduce turbulence and promote smoother flow, while the tips, often large and angular, serve as the final sound-shaping element. To replicate this, consider upgrading to a performance muffler with a straight-through design, such as those from MagnaFlow or Borla, which offer a balance between sound and performance. Pair this with mandrel-bent pipes, ensuring a consistent diameter throughout, to maintain optimal flow.
Instructive Steps: Begin by assessing your current exhaust system, identifying areas for improvement. Measure the diameter of your existing pipes and select upgrades that match or exceed this size, ensuring compatibility. When installing a new muffler, ensure it’s positioned to allow for adequate clearance and heat dissipation. For tips, opt for larger, more angular designs that mimic Lamborghini's aesthetic and acoustic properties. Remember, the goal is not just to amplify sound but to refine it, creating a harmonious note that resonates with the Lamborghini signature.

Engine Tuning: Adjust ECU settings to enhance throttle response and create aggressive engine sounds
The heart of a Lamborghini's roar lies in its engine's character, a symphony of power and precision. To replicate this in your vehicle, engine tuning through ECU (Engine Control Unit) adjustments is a potent strategy. The ECU, essentially the brain of your car's engine, governs fuel injection, ignition timing, and other critical parameters. By recalibrating these settings, you can unlock a more aggressive throttle response and, consequently, a more formidable exhaust note.
Unleashing the Beast: ECU Tuning Techniques
ECU tuning involves modifying the software that controls the engine's performance. This process can be done through various methods, such as using handheld tuning devices or seeking professional services. The goal is to optimize the engine's behavior, allowing it to respond more eagerly to throttle inputs. For instance, adjusting the fuel map can increase fuel delivery during acceleration, resulting in a more rapid and aggressive power surge. This not only improves performance but also contributes to a deeper, more resonant engine sound.
The Art of Sound Engineering
Creating a Lamborghini-esque sound isn't merely about increasing volume; it's about crafting a distinctive auditory signature. ECU tuning can manipulate the engine's rev behavior, encouraging it to hold gears longer and produce a more sustained, throaty growl. By adjusting the ignition timing, you can control the combustion process, influencing the frequency and tone of the exhaust note. A well-tuned ECU can make the engine's sound more crisp and defined, mimicking the high-performance characteristics of a Lamborghini's V10 or V12 powerplants.
Practical Considerations and Caution
While ECU tuning offers exciting possibilities, it's essential to approach it with caution. Aggressive tuning can strain engine components, potentially leading to increased wear and reduced reliability. It's crucial to strike a balance between performance gains and long-term durability. Additionally, legal considerations vary by region, with some areas having strict regulations on vehicle modifications. Always ensure that any modifications comply with local laws to avoid penalties.
Fine-Tuning for the Perfect Symphony
Achieving the desired sound and performance requires a meticulous approach. Start with conservative adjustments, gradually increasing the aggressiveness of the tune while monitoring the engine's behavior. Modern ECUs often provide real-time data, allowing you to analyze parameters like air-fuel ratio, boost pressure (if applicable), and exhaust gas temperatures. This data-driven approach ensures that the engine remains within safe operating limits while delivering the desired auditory and performance enhancements. With careful calibration, your vehicle can not only sound like a Lamborghini but also respond with a similar level of urgency and precision.

Sound Amplifiers: Add electronic sound enhancers or active exhaust systems to simulate Lamborghini acoustics
Electronic sound enhancers and active exhaust systems are the modern alchemists of automotive acoustics, transforming your everyday vehicle’s growl into a Lamborghini’s roar. These systems work by amplifying, modulating, or synthesizing engine sounds, either through speakers or by manipulating exhaust flow. Unlike traditional exhaust modifications, which rely on passive components, active systems use electronic valves and sound processors to dynamically adjust the noise profile. For instance, brands like Milltek and Akrapovič offer active exhausts that mimic the high-pitched, throaty bellow of a Lamborghini V10 or V12, complete with pops and crackles on deceleration. The key lies in their ability to adapt sound output based on driving mode, RPM, or even GPS data, ensuring authenticity across all driving conditions.
Installing an active exhaust system isn’t a plug-and-play affair—it requires careful consideration of your vehicle’s compatibility and legal restrictions. Most aftermarket kits include ECU tuning modules to sync the exhaust’s behavior with your engine’s performance, but professional installation is recommended to avoid voiding warranties or triggering error codes. Sound enhancers, on the other hand, are more accessible. Devices like the SoundRacer or Active Sound Exhaust systems mount directly to your chassis and sync with your engine’s RPM via an OBD-II port, emitting Lamborghini-like frequencies through internal or external speakers. While these won’t alter your actual exhaust note, they’re a budget-friendly option for those who prioritize sound over mechanical authenticity.
The persuasive appeal of sound amplifiers lies in their ability to deliver Lamborghini acoustics without the exorbitant cost of a full engine or exhaust overhaul. For example, a Milltek active exhaust for a BMW 3 Series can cost around $3,000, while a Lamborghini-style sound enhancer like the Exhaust Notes Simulator retails for under $500. However, purists argue that synthesized sound lacks the soul of a genuine V12. To counter this, some systems, like those from iPE (Iron Prince Exhaust), combine active exhaust valves with sound generators, blending mechanical and electronic enhancements for a more holistic experience. This hybrid approach bridges the gap between affordability and authenticity, making it a compelling choice for enthusiasts.
A comparative analysis reveals that while active exhausts offer a more organic sound, they’re limited by your vehicle’s existing exhaust architecture. Sound enhancers, though less authentic, provide greater flexibility in tone customization. For instance, some devices allow users to switch between Lamborghini, Ferrari, or even Formula 1 sound profiles via smartphone apps. Additionally, active exhausts may face legal hurdles in noise-restricted areas, whereas sound enhancers can be toggled off at the push of a button. Ultimately, the choice depends on your priorities: mechanical purity or technological versatility.
To maximize the effectiveness of sound amplifiers, follow these practical tips: ensure your vehicle’s exhaust system is free of leaks, as imperfections can distort the amplified sound; calibrate the device to match your engine’s RPM range for seamless integration; and experiment with mounting locations to optimize acoustic projection. For active exhausts, pair them with a high-flow catalytic converter and performance headers to enhance both sound and power. Exhaust Tips Design: Use oversized, angled tips to mimic Lamborghini's distinctive rear exhaust appearance and sound
Lamborghinis are renowned for their aggressive exhaust notes, a symphony of power that turns heads and quickens pulses. A key contributor to this signature sound is the design of their exhaust tips. Oversized and angled, these tips aren't just for show; they play a crucial role in shaping the exhaust's tone and character.
Imagine the difference between a whisper and a roar. Standard exhaust tips, often smaller and straight, muffle the sound, creating a more subdued note. Lamborghini's angled tips, on the other hand, act like a megaphone, amplifying the exhaust's natural growl and directing it outward, creating a more pronounced and directional sound.
Achieving this effect requires careful consideration. The angle of the tips is paramount. A steeper angle will project the sound further and create a more dramatic effect, while a shallower angle will provide a more subtle enhancement. Material choice is also important. Stainless steel, with its durability and corrosion resistance, is a popular option, while titanium offers a lighter weight and a unique, slightly higher-pitched sound.
Size matters too. Oversized tips not only contribute to the visual impact but also allow for a larger exhaust flow, reducing backpressure and potentially increasing horsepower. However, it's crucial to strike a balance. Excessively large tips can lead to a boomy, undefined sound.
Installation requires precision. The tips must be aligned perfectly to ensure proper exhaust flow and prevent leaks. Professional installation is recommended, especially for those unfamiliar with exhaust systems. Additionally, local noise regulations should be considered. While the Lamborghini sound is desirable, excessive noise can lead to fines and legal issues.
By carefully selecting the size, angle, and material of your exhaust tips, you can significantly alter your car's sound, bringing it closer to the iconic roar of a Lamborghini.
